CD74HCT393M Binary Counter IC Equivalent & Substitute Parts
Part Overview
The CD74HCT393M is a dual 4-bit binary counter logic IC manufactured by Texas Instruments in a 14-SOIC surface mount package. This component functions as a negative edge-triggered counter with asynchronous reset capability, operating at a maximum count rate of 27 MHz within a 4.5 V to 5.5 V supply voltage range. Engineering Selection Recommendations
CD74HCT393M96 is the direct equivalent substitute from Texas Instruments. This part maintains identical electrical specifications, temperature range, and count rate performance while offering active product status and improved supply availability. The packaging format difference (tape & reel versus tube) does not affect functional compatibility.
74HCT393D,653 from Nexperia USA Inc. is a functionally compatible alternative that meets all core substitution criteria. This part offers a higher maximum count rate of 107 MHz, providing performance margin beyond the original specification. The operating temperature range is narrower (-40°C to 125°C versus -55°C to 125°C), which may be a consideration for applications requiring extended low-temperature operation below -40°C. Both parts maintain ROHS3 compliance and MSL Level 1 rating.
For applications with no low-temperature operation below -40°C, either substitute provides equivalent functionality. For designs requiring the full -55°C to 125°C temperature range, CD74HCT393M96 is the preferred selection.
Frequently Asked Questions (FAQ)
Q: Can CD74HCT393M96 be used as a direct replacement for CD74HCT393M?
A: Yes. CD74HCT393M96 is electrically and functionally identical to CD74HCT393M. The only difference is packaging format (tape & reel versus tube). Both parts share the same pin configuration, electrical specifications, and performance characteristics.
Q: What is the difference between CD74HCT393M96 and 74HCT393D,653?
A: Both are functionally compatible substitutes. CD74HCT393M96 maintains identical specifications to the original part, including the -55°C to 125°C operating temperature range. The 74HCT393D,653 offers a higher count rate (107 MHz versus 27 MHz) but operates only to -40°C minimum temperature. Select based on your application's temperature requirements.
Q: Does packaging format affect substitutability?
A: No. Tube and tape & reel packaging formats contain identical die and electrical performance. The packaging difference affects only handling, storage, and automated assembly compatibility. Electrical and functional substitutability is unaffected.
Q: Are all substitute parts ROHS3 compliant?
A: Yes. CD74HCT393M96 and 74HCT393D,653 are both ROHS3 compliant with MSL Level 1 rating, matching the original part's compliance status.
Q: Can I use 74HCT393D,653 in applications requiring -55°C operation?
A: No. The 74HCT393D,653 is rated only to -40°C minimum. For applications requiring operation below -40°C, use CD74HCT393M96, which maintains the full -55°C to 125°C range.
